What Are Commercial Solar Panels?
Commercial solar panels are large-scale solar photovoltaic (PV) systems specifically designed for business use. Unlike residential solar panels, which cater to individual homes, commercial setups are tailored to fit the unique energy needs of larger facilities or corporations. Typically mounted on rooftops or ground-mounted in solar farms, these systems convert sunlight into electricity through interconnected solar cells. The stored energy can be utilized for internal consumption, offsetting utility bills, or even returning surplus power to the grid.
Benefits of Using Solar Panels for Businesses
Investing in solar panels presents numerous advantages for businesses in Lincoln:
- Cost Savings: Companies can significantly cut their electricity bills by generating their own power. Over time, the savings accumulated can result in a substantial return on investment (ROI).
- Energy Independence: By generating their own electricity, businesses become less dependent on fluctuating energy markets, which can provide a hedge against rising utility costs.
- Environmental Impact: Utilizing solar energy helps reduce greenhouse gas emissions, contributing positively to climate change efforts and improving a company’s sustainability image.
- Brand Reputation: Companies investing in clean energy often attract environmentally conscious consumers, enhancing their brand identity and potentially increasing customer loyalty.
- Increased Property Value: Properties equipped with solar energy systems can have higher market values due to reduced operating costs and appealing green credentials.

Cost Considerations for Commercial Solar Panels in Lincoln
Initial Investment in Solar Panel Systems
The initial cost of commercial solar panel systems can vary widely based on factors such as system size, complexity, and installation configurations. Typically, the average commercial solar installation costs about $1.46 per watt. Consequently, a standard 100 kW system could range from approximately £90,000 to £150,000, depending on the specific components chosen.
It is vital for businesses to assess the upfront investment against long-term energy savings. Detailed projections can reveal how quickly a system can pay for itself through reduced electricity expenses.

Key Factors to Consider Before Installation
Before proceeding with the installation of commercial solar panels, businesses should consider several crucial factors:
- Site Assessment: An accurate assessment of the installation site is critical to determine how much sunlight is available and the potential energy output.
- Energy Needs Analysis: Understanding the energy requirements of the business allows for the design of a system that optimally meets usage demands.
- System Design: The design should maximize efficiency while considering features such as panel orientation and shading from nearby structures.
- Grid Connection: Evaluate options for grid connectivity and understand how excess energy generation can be credited or compensated.

Optimizing Solar Energy Usage for Businesses
Understanding Load Management and Energy Storage
Implementing a solar energy system is not just about installing panels; it also involves managing how the energy generated is consumed. Load management systems can help monitor energy use and optimize when to draw from solar resources versus the grid.
Additionally, installing energy storage systems, like batteries, allows businesses to store excess energy generated during sunny days for use during peak demand hours or at night. This capability not only ensures a steady energy supply but also maximizes the cost-effectiveness of the solar investment.
Best Practices for Maintaining Solar Panels
To ensure that solar panels continue to operate efficiently, regular maintenance is crucial. Best practices include:
- Regular Cleaning: Dust, dirt, and debris can accumulate on panels, blocking sunlight and reducing efficiency. Regular cleanings, either by professionals or through self-service with appropriate tools, are advised.
- Periodic Inspections: Routine checks ensure that all components are functioning correctly and can help identify problems before they escalate.
- Monitoring Performance: Utilizing monitoring systems can provide insights into energy production and potential issues, allowing for quick corrections as necessary.

Upcoming Technologies and Innovations in Solar Panels
The solar industry is rapidly evolving due to innovations in technology, making solar energy systems more efficient, affordable, and accessible. Some anticipated advancements include:
- Bifacial Solar Panels: These panels can capture sunlight from both sides, increasing energy generation potential.
- Building-Integrated Photovoltaics (BIPV): These innovative systems integrate solar cells into building materials, serving dual purposes of power generation and structural integrity.
- Improved Energy Storage Technologies: Advances in battery technology will enhance energy storage capabilities, allowing businesses to rely more on solar power during peak demand hours.
